I think people were upset about Lilo because the Lilo & Stitch franchise is exactly that. Lilo AND Stitch. not just Stitch. Lilo fans were insulted because the dynamic has always been a pair and she was cut out of two animation. The Japanese one and the Chinese one (maybe that is not called an anime though so animation is the term I will use). It's like doing Lady and the Tramp but only centering on Tramp's adventures in new spinoff shows.

I think having adult Lilo cameo was more throwing a bone to acknowledge her existence but I don't think American Disney would appreciate it because it ages the character and Disney characters are supposed to be timeless and never age. Stitch will always look the same and Lilo will always look the same and be a child. I think we only saw adult Lilo because it was a decision set in Japan for the anime and didn't influence Lilo's portrayal in America.
